    Buy dot com cannot be trusted. In early 2007, they offered several Connect3D products as “free” after rebate. After six months, Connect3D is failing to pay these rebates and Buy dot com is giving their customers the run-around. They started issuing refunds to the first customers that complained. When they became overwhelmed with complaints, they stopped paying. Don’t forget, this was an exclusive Buy dot com and Connect3D rebate which greatly increased sales for Buy. Buy dot com took all the profits and let their customers unknowingly assume all the risk…. Buy dot com does not seem to care about their customers.

    On 1/26/07 I purchased a Connect3D 2 gigabyte USB drive from Buy.com for $50.00. This purchase was made contingent upon a $50 manufacturer’s rebate, which should have been issued in April, 2007. Buy.com represented that the rebate was to be made, and even provided a link to the rebate form on their website.

    After numerous attempts by phone, mail, and e-mail to both the manufacturer and Buy.com, no action has been taken. I have been informed that Connect3D is now out of business, and as I understand the FTC rules regarding rebates (the CompUSA case in particular) Buy.com is liable for the rebate payment to me.

    To date, after many attempts buy phone and e-mail, Buy.com has not paid me, but has offered a $10 coupon. I view their actions as despicable. As I understand it, several other vendors were caught when Connect3D closed business, and they stood by their customers.
